The state transportation system is inextricably woven into the fabric of Idaho life. The states citizens use Idahos transportation system to get to work, school, friends and recreation. They also rely on that system to bring goods to their stores, services to their doorstep, and to make sure the states goods and services are delivered to the customers of the nation and the world. From the food they eat, to the letters they read, to the movies they drive to, Idahoans are empowered by transportation in complex and substantial ways. Idahos leaders and transportation officials understand the essential role transportation plays as a cornerstone for the states economic and social health. The transportation departments mandate is to provide the people of Idaho with a transportation system that includes various means of travel. dahos transportation system is the backbone of the states economy. Safe and efficient roads, bridges, airports, railroads and ports promote the expansion of Idahos economy. The cost of doing business is affected by how well goods and people can be moved across town, across the country and around the world. Thus, Idahos economic performance is tied to the quality of our transportation system.
